Versions in this module Expand all Collapse all v0 v0.12.5 Mar 24, 2026 Changes in this version + func ConvertWorkflowDefsToTools(defs map[string]*composer.WorkflowDefinition) []vmcp.Tool + func FilterWorkflowDefsForSession(defs map[string]*composer.WorkflowDefinition, rt *vmcp.RoutingTable) map[string]*composer.WorkflowDefinition + func NewDecorator(sess sessiontypes.MultiSession, compositeTools []vmcp.Tool, ...) sessiontypes.MultiSession + func ValidateNoToolConflicts(backendTools, compositeTools []vmcp.Tool) error + type WorkflowExecutor interface + ExecuteWorkflow func(ctx context.Context, params map[string]any) (*WorkflowResult, error) + type WorkflowResult struct + Error error + Output map[string]any